<p>26.04.2002 Data sheet D.AED9301A.0e</p><p>AED9301A</p><p>Basic device for AD101B or AD103</p><p>• DP V1 Profibus interface</p><p>• For cyclic und acyclic operation</p><p>• Two control inputs and two limit value</p><p>outputs with AD101B amplifier</p><p>• Six control inputs / outputs with</p><p>AD103 amplifier (Dosing function)</p><p>• Test certificate for 6000 digits class</p><p>III available</p><p>• 18...30V Operating voltage range</p><p>• Protection class IP65</p><p>• EMC protection</p><p>Special features</p><p>Basic device</p><p>AED9301A</p><p>Amplifier PCB</p><p>AD101B or AD103</p><p>AED9301A Basic device (Dimensions in mm; 1mm = 0.03937 inches)</p><p>fixing holes</p><p>2 x ∅5</p><p>(view from below)</p><p>45</p><p>2</p><p>TRANSDUCER PROFIBUS</p><p>DIGITAL I/O</p><p>POWER</p><p>~1</p><p>00</p><p>~195</p><p>HOTTINGER BALDWINMESSTECHNIK</p><p>The complete measuring chain incl. AED in the shielded</p><p>assembly is immune from high--frequency radiation</p><p>and cable--based interferences acc. to OIML R76,</p><p>EN 45501 or EN 61326--1 (interference emission) and</p><p>EN 61326--1+A1 (interference immunity) respectively</p><p>PG9 (5x)</p><p>~67</p><p>~5</p><p>2</p><p>~163</p><p>D.AED9301A.0e -- 26.04.2002</p><p>Technical data</p><p>Type AED9301A</p><p>Measuring signal input (AD101B, AD103) mV/V ±3, nominal ±2</p><p>Transducer connection:</p><p>Strain gage transducer (full bridge)</p><p>Transducer connection</p><p>Transducer cable length</p><p>Bridge excitation voltage</p><p>Ω</p><p>m</p><p>VDC</p><p>≥80...4000</p><p>6--wire circuit</p><p>≤100</p><p>5</p><p>Profibus DP:</p><p>Protocol</p><p>Baud rate, max.</p><p>Subcriber adress, can be set by rotary switch</p><p>Profibus Ident number</p><p>Configuration data</p><p>Parameter data, max.</p><p>Parameter setting (asynchron)</p><p>Input data, max.</p><p>Output data, max.</p><p>Updating time inputs</p><p>Updating time outputs</p><p>Interface cable length Profibus</p><p>Mbaud</p><p>Byte</p><p>Byte</p><p>Byte</p><p>Byte</p><p>Byte</p><p>ms</p><p>ms</p><p>m</p><p>m</p><p>m</p><p>m</p><p>m</p><p>Profibus--DP Slave, according to DIN 19245--3</p><p>12</p><p>3...99</p><p>0x069A</p><p>5</p><p>6 (+7DP--Norm)</p><p>according to DPV1--Standard, class C2</p><p>30</p><p>33</p><p><10 (1 measured value)</p><p>20</p><p>1200 (bei 9.6 / 19.2 / 93.75kBit/s)</p><p>1000 (at 187.5kBit/s)</p><p>400 (at 500kBit/s)</p><p>200 (at 1.5MBit/s)</p><p>100 (at 12MBit/s)</p><p>Control inputs (electrically isolated):</p><p>Number</p><p>Input voltage range, LOW</p><p>Input voltage range, HIGH</p><p>Input current, typ., HIGH--level = 24V</p><p>Insulation voltage, typ.</p><p>V</p><p>V</p><p>mA</p><p>VDC</p><p>2</p><p>0...5</p><p>10...30</p><p>12</p><p>500</p><p>Control outputs *) (electrically isolated):</p><p>Number</p><p>Max. output current Imax per output</p><p>Short circuit current, typ., Ub=24V; RL <0.1Ohms</p><p>Short circuit duration</p><p>Input current at LOW level</p><p>Output voltage HIGH level</p><p>Insulation voltage, typ.</p><p>A</p><p>A</p><p>mA</p><p>V</p><p>VDC</p><p>Supply from operating voltage</p><p>4</p><p>0.5</p><p>0.8</p><p>Unlimited</p><p><2</p><p>>15 at Imax</p><p>500</p><p>Supply:</p><p>Operating voltage</p><p>Current consumption (without load cell and</p><p>control output current Iout 1...4)</p><p>VDC</p><p>mA</p><p>18...30</p><p>≤250 **)</p><p>Temperature range: Nominal temperature</p><p>Operating temperature</p><p>Storage temperature</p><p>°C [°F]</p><p>--10...+40 [+14...+104]</p><p>--20...+60 [--4...+140]</p><p>--25...+85 [--13...185]</p><p>Dimensions mm 195 x 100 x 70</p><p>Weight g ~950</p><p>Protection class according to DIN 40050 (IEC 529) IP65</p><p>*) Depending on the external operating voltage supply</p><p>**) Current consumption = ≤ 250mA (18V--Supply) +</p><p>**) Current consumption = ≤ 200mA (24V--Supply) +</p><p>**) Current consumption = ≤ 200mA (30V--Supply) +</p><p>Supply voltage UB = 5V</p><p>Bridge resistance RB</p><p>+ ∑ Iout 1...4</p><p>Order designations:</p><p>1--AED9301BASIC = Basic device AED9301A with AD101B amplifier PCB</p><p>1--AED9301PLUS = Basic device AED9301A with AD103 amplifier PCB</p><p>1--AED9301A = Basic device AED9301A without amplifier PCB</p><p>1--AD101B = Amplifier PCB AD101B (see separate Data sheet)</p><p>1--AD103 = Amplifier PCB with dosing function AD103 (see separate Data sheet)</p><p>Documentation (Please order separately)</p><p>1--AED/DOC = CD--ROM with operating manual and AED--Panel program</p><p>wt 04.02 -- (pdf)</p><p>Modifications reserved.</p><p>All details describe our products in</p><p>general form.
